Modeling the Effects of Decreased Level of GABA and Accumulation of GHB on GABA Receptors and its Effect on Pediatric/ Neonatal Seizures

The receptor sites of the GABAA, GABAB and GHB receptors have been identified and the interactional analysis have been carried out using GABA and GHB molecules. The rate of interaction, mode of interaction the site of interaction and the way of interaction have been identified.
